HC Deb 15 September 1950 vol 478 c174W
Major Lloyd

asked the Chancellor of the Exchequer what is the total amount so far paid out as gratuities to temporary civil servants who have resigned their employment.

Mr. Gaitskell

Under the Superannuation Act of 1949 gratuities are payable to-unestablished staff with at least seven years' service on termination of their service, whether as a result of redundancy, ill health, age or resignation. Separate records are not kept of the amounts paid under the various causes of termination, but the total amount paid in gratuities to unestablished staff between 14th July, 1949, and 31st August, 1950, was approximately £1,850,000.
